  • 2014 Ford Mustang GT, 6 speed, Cobra Jet intake/long tube headers and a tune with Borla Touring axle backs. Upper/lower control arms and Koni shocks/struts with Eibach pro-kit springs. Makes 440whp on the dyno

    Beautiful looking 5.0! One of the nicest I've seen actually. I was curious as to where it was run at because of the times and trap speed. I'm guessing this was done at high altitude because this 5.0 is making about 60-70 more RWHP than a stock 2014 5.0 which runs about the same ET and trap speed you're running. Your driving and shifting look good, so it has to either be high altitude, or extremely hot temps, or both. I loved the video though. Thanks for sharing it.

    • @CasualRacing
      @CasualRacing  6 лет назад +1

      Hi Chris I am not the driver of the car but this was ran at Mission Raceway Park in BC, Canada. I think the issue was also traction as he was not running drag radials so the starts were not ideal. Altitude I believe is around 800ft at this time of day. The best time the driver has ran was a 12.44 @ 117mph. I feel that a set of drag radials would help with bringing the times down.

    decent times! do you shift at red line? i cant beat 12.8 with my manual 13 gt. i do have 331s

    • @jeffl3224
      @jeffl3224 6 лет назад

      was running slower than usual that night. was a pretty hot night and I find I get better times shifting around 72-7500. This night I was taking it too high around 7800 (normal for CJ) but still have run better shifting earlier. Done a 12.44 @117 but still only a 2.0 60ft. And last run i got locked outta 4th hence the slow time/mph
